919 GitHub courses

Learn Modern OpenGL Programming

By Packt

Create your own 3D Graphics with OpenGL and C++

Learn Modern OpenGL Programming
Delivered Online On Demand10 hours 29 minutes
£33.99

Ultimate Guide to Raspberry Pi - Tips, Tricks, and Hacks

By Packt

This course will provide the information you need to master the Raspberry Pi 3 and Raspberry Pi 4. It walks you through everything you need to know to use the platform to the fullest and assumes no prior programming or electronics knowledge. The course also covers details about Raspberry Pi OS and Raspberry Pi Imager.

Ultimate Guide to Raspberry Pi - Tips, Tricks, and Hacks
Delivered Online On Demand4 hours 43 minutes
£68.99

Applied Machine Learning with BigQuery on Google Cloud

By Packt

Learn to design, plan, and scale cloud implementations with Google Cloud Platform's BigQuery. This course will walk you through the fundamentals of applied machine learning and BigQuery ML along with its history, architecture, and use cases.

Applied Machine Learning with BigQuery on Google Cloud
Delivered Online On Demand2 hours 28 minutes
£19.99

AI for Teachers with ChatGPT

By Packt

Are you fascinated by the possibilities that AI holds for transforming the education sector? If so, you have come to the right place. This course delves into the captivating world of AI and discovers how it can revolutionize education. If you are seeking to expand your horizons or are eager to explore the intersections of AI and education, this course provides an exciting and tailor-made learning experience.

AI for Teachers with ChatGPT
Delivered Online On Demand1 hour 16 minutes
£33.99

Bash Scripting and Shell Programming (Linux Command Line)

By Packt

Learn bash programming for Linux, Unix, & Mac. Learn how to write bash scripts like a pro & solve real-world problems!

Bash Scripting and Shell Programming (Linux Command Line)
Delivered Online On Demand1 hour 57 minutes
£93.99

A Beginners Guide to Linux

By Packt

A structured approach to learning and master Linux quickly

A Beginners Guide to Linux
Delivered Online On Demand2 hours 16 minutes
£37.99

Real-Time Stream Processing Using Apache Spark 3 for Scala Developers

By Packt

Learn the process to design and develop big data engineering projects using Apache Spark. This example-driven advanced-level course will help you understand real-time stream processing using Apache Spark and you can apply that knowledge to build real-time stream processing solutions.

Real-Time Stream Processing Using Apache Spark 3 for Scala Developers
Delivered Online On Demand3 hours 23 minutes
£22.99

Fundamentals of Object-Oriented Programming - C++

By Packt

The course is designed to provide complete knowledge of object-oriented programming using C++. We will discuss some core OOP concepts such as classes, objects, functions, encapsulation, and polymorphism. Along with learning how to design implement classes, we will cover the best practices for writing and maintaining code

Fundamentals of Object-Oriented Programming - C++
Delivered Online On Demand7 hours 6 minutes
£22.99

Scrum Training for Project Management and Certification Prep

By Packt

This course gives a complete overview of the Scrum framework for Agile project management. Anyone involved in product delivery using the Scrum framework will find this course helpful, but it is particularly beneficial for those in the organization accountable for getting the most out of Scrum, including Scrum masters, managers, and Scrum team members.

Scrum Training for Project Management and Certification Prep
Delivered Online On Demand2 hours
£22.99

Software Engineering: Software Programming, Web Design & Development

4.8(12)

By Academy for Health and Fitness

Software Engineering:  Software Programming, Web Design & Development
Delivered Online On Demand7 days
£209